On Saturday, October 9, 2010 from 9:00 A.M. – 3:00 P.M. the Newport News Police Department, in conjunction with the Virginia State Police Help Eliminate Auto Theft (H.E.A.T.) program, will host a VIN Etching event at Patrick Henry Mall. During this event the federally assigned number known as a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) will be permanently etched on the vehicle’s windows. In addition to cars and trucks, for the first time on the Peninsula, this event will also include motorcycles.
In addition to the fact that disposing of a vehicle whose windows have been VIN etched takes time, trouble and money, all in short supply for thieves, VIN etching obliterates any potential profit professional thieves might have gleaned from the lucrative practice of selling windows and windshields for parts via chop shops.
The VIN Etching service takes only a few minutes to perform and is provided at no cost.
The H.E.A.T. program is a cooperative effort of the Virginia Department of State Police, Virginia Department of Motor Vehicles, and local law enforcement agencies across the Commonwealth, in an effort to reduce auto theft.
